Jim Bernard Corsi, also known as Jim Corsi, was an American professional baseball pitcher.

He was also a right-handed MLB bullpen pitcher and a Massachusetts native who spent three seasons with the Boston Red Sox. He died surrounded by friends and family on Tuesday morning.

According to key officials, Jim Corsi, who was 60 years old at the time of his death, was facing terminal cancer.

He also played Major League Baseball for the Oakland Athletics, Houston Astros, Florida Marlins, Boston Red Sox, and Baltimore Orioles (MLB).

Corsi had a 22–24 win–loss record in 368 games pitched for MLB over ten seasons, with all but one in relief. He had a 3.25 ERA in 481 innings pitched, striking out 290 hitters and making seven saves.

What Cancer Did Jim Corsi Have? What Caused Jim Corsi’s Death?

Jim Corsi, a former Red Sox reliever, announced his diagnosis of stage four liver and colon cancer in January 2022.

In truth, his health had deteriorated since that November interview. In October, he led his daughter down the aisle.

He also discussed how cancer had affected him and advised everyone to get regular health checks.
